Twenty trays, one set of wheels.

The rack every bakery, pizzeria and catering kitchen ends up with three of, because trays have to go somewhere while they cool.

A bun pan rack is where bread proves, pastry cools, pizza bases wait and a catering job stacks up before it goes out the door. This one takes twenty full-size sheet pans, or forty half-size, on runners spaced for air to move between them. The whole thing is aluminium, so it weighs under 14 kg empty and never rusts, and the rack is rated to 240 kg loaded.

It rolls on four castors, two with brakes, so a full rack moves from the oven to the cooling corner to the van and stays put when you lock it. The edges are polished and rounded to protect your hands.

Questions

Which trays fit?

Full-size sheet pans, about 660 × 457 mm, one per tier, or half-size pans, about 457 × 330 mm, two per tier side by side. Standard gastronorm trays with a rim also slide on the runners.

How far apart are the runners?

Twenty tiers over the height of the rack. If you need more height for a tall loaf, skip a tier.

Do I have to fit the castors?

No. They bolt on if you want the rack to roll and stay in the box if you do not. Most kitchens fit them; a rack that moves to the oven and back is the point.

Will it go through a doorway and into a van?

It is 660 mm wide and 1767 mm tall, so it rolls through a standard 820 mm door upright. For a van, tip it and load it flat; empty, it is under 14 kg.

Can I cover it for proving?

Yes. A rack cover with a zip front turns it into a proving cabinet at room temperature and keeps flies off trays waiting to cool. Any cover made for a full-height 20 tier rack fits.
